What is common among amylase, rennin and trypsin?
A. All are proteins
B. Proteolytic enzyme
C. Produced in stomach
D. Act at pH lower than 7

Correct Answer - A
Common among amylase, rennin and trypsin is that these all are enzymes/proteins.
